NoPo - No Post, Allows you to block a specific tagged post from being seen on your tumblr homepage. Created by Macleod Sawyer (link to blog here)
Update: If your theme currently has < article >
in the code for posts, this method will not work till I rework it. Fixed the issue. scroll down to see the fix!
<style>
{block:IndexPage}
.x {
display:none;
}
{/block:IndexPage}
{block:TagPage}
.x {
display:block;
}
{/block:TagPage}
</style>
(be sure to change 'x' to the tag name you are going to tag the posts to hide from your theme):
<div class="post"> (commonly called entry)
(the value of 'post' may be called something different as well)
{TagsAsClasses}
so it looks similar to this:
<div class="(whatever you found in step 7) {TagsAsClasses}">
The space between )
and {
is very important.
Now anything you tag with the tag you selected in step four in the css will no longer show up on the first page on your blog! (but will show up on permalinks like /post/94769233934/x/, and tagged pages like /tagged/x/!
